Full Bucket Seats for Safe Swinging
For toddlers and younger children, full bucket seats are essential. These seats offer secure support and stability, reducing the risk of accidental slips as they swing.
Safety Features of Bucket Seats:
- Keeps young children securely seated
- Deep bucket design prevents falls
- Ideal for those developing balance and coordination
Soft Grip Chains
Traditional metal chains can pose risks for tiny hands. Soft grip chains, typically coated in plastic, are a safer alternative.
Safety Features of Soft Grip Chains:
- Prevents pinched fingers
- Offers a comfortable grip
- Reduces rust and wear over time

Safety Surfacing for a Cushioned Play Area
The ground under your swing set is as important as the set itself. Proper safety surfacing minimizes injuries from falls.
Tips for Choosing Your Safety Surfacing:
- Options include rubber mulch, wood chips, or impact-absorbing mats
- Grass or concrete alone is not sufficient
- Adding the right surface beneath your play area ahead of time will ensure peace of mind upon those inevitable tumbles
